‘Armed forces at forefront in ridding criminal elements’

The Chief of Defence Staff, General Abayomi Olonisakin, has assured that the Armed Forces are at the forefront in ridding out criminal elements with a view to restoring normalcy to the country.

Speaking during the graduation of 106 Direct Short Service Cadets held at the Military Training Center in Kaduna yesterday, the CDS challenged officers and men of the Nigeria Air Force (NAF) to remain loyal, disciplined, dedicated and patriotic in their assignments.

He told the cadets that the service would not compromise on discipline and patriotism, adding that they must gear up to be part of the efforts to restore peace in parts of the country.
